Continued work on the Beethoven Sonatina. I will be starting the 2nd movement this week!
On the first movement, I'm maintaining slower-than-performance-tempo-practice to gain some much needed continuity and confidence. This recording is with the metronome at 76bpm (ultimate tempo goal 100-110 to the quarter note). I started using the pedal in the coda at the request of my teacher - not so sure I like it after having played the rest of the movement without pedal. I'll have to play around with it to become accustomed to this new sound and then decide whether or not I like it.
